+func fastWriteResponseContent(filename, mimeType string, rs io.ReadSeeker, ctx *fasthttp.RequestCtx) error {
+ totalSize, e := rs.Seek(0, 2)
+ if mimeType == "" {
+ if ext := path.Ext(filename); ext != "" {
+ mimeType = mime.TypeByExtension(ext)
+ }
+ }
+ if mimeType != "" {
+ ctx.Response.Header.Set("Content-Type", mimeType)
+ }
+ if filename != "" {
+ contentDisposition := "inline"
+ dlFormValue := ctx.FormValue("dl")
+ if dlFormValue != nil {
+ if dl, _ := strconv.ParseBool(string(dlFormValue)); dl {
+ contentDisposition = "attachment"
+ }
+ }
+ ctx.Response.Header.Set("Content-Disposition", contentDisposition+`; filename="`+fileNameEscaper.Replace(filename)+`"`)
+ }
+ ctx.Response.Header.Set("Accept-Ranges", "bytes")
+ if ctx.IsHead() {
+ ctx.Response.Header.Set("Content-Length", strconv.FormatInt(totalSize, 10))
+ return nil
+ }
+ rangeReq := ctx.FormValue("Range")
+ if rangeReq == nil {
+ ctx.Response.Header.Set("Content-Length", strconv.FormatInt(totalSize, 10))
+ if _, e = rs.Seek(0, 0); e != nil {
+ return e
+ }
+ _, e = io.Copy(ctx.Response.BodyWriter(), rs)
+ return e
+ }
+
+ //the rest is dealing with partial content request
+ //mostly copy from src/pkg/net/http/fs.go
+ ranges, err := parseRange(string(rangeReq), totalSize)
+ if err != nil {
+ ctx.Response.SetStatusCode(http.StatusRequestedRangeNotSatisfiable)
+ ctxError(ctx, err.Error(), http.StatusRequestedRangeNotSatisfiable)
+ return nil
+ }
+ if sumRangesSize(ranges) > totalSize {
+ // The total number of bytes in all the ranges
+ // is larger than the size of the file by
+ // itself, so this is probably an attack, or a
+ // dumb client. Ignore the range request.
+ return nil
+ }
+ if len(ranges) == 0 {
+ return nil
+ }
+ if len(ranges) == 1 {
+ // RFC 2616, Section 14.16:
+ // "When an HTTP message includes the content of a single
+ // range (for example, a response to a request for a
+ // single range, or to a request for a set of ranges
+ // that overlap without any holes), this content is
+ // transmitted with a Content-Range header, and a
+ // Content-Length header showing the number of bytes
+ // actually transferred.
+ // ...
+ // A response to a request for a single range MUST NOT
+ // be sent using the multipart/byteranges media type."
+ ra := ranges[0]
+ ctx.Response.Header.Set("Content-Length", strconv.FormatInt(ra.length, 10))
+ ctx.Response.Header.Set("Content-Range", ra.contentRange(totalSize))
+ ctx.Response.SetStatusCode(http.StatusPartialContent)
+ if _, e = rs.Seek(ra.start, 0); e != nil {
+ return e
+ }
+
+ _, e = io.CopyN(ctx.Response.BodyWriter(), rs, ra.length)
+ return e
+ }
+ // process multiple ranges
+ for _, ra := range ranges {
+ if ra.start > totalSize {
+ ctxError(ctx, "Out of Range", http.StatusRequestedRangeNotSatisfiable)
+ return nil
+ }
+ }
+ sendSize := rangesMIMESize(ranges, mimeType, totalSize)
+ pr, pw := io.Pipe()
+ mw := multipart.NewWriter(pw)
+ ctx.Response.Header.Set("Content-Type", "multipart/byteranges; boundary="+mw.Boundary())
+ sendContent := pr
+ defer pr.Close() // cause writing goroutine to fail and exit if CopyN doesn't finish.
+ go func() {
+ for _, ra := range ranges {
+ part, e := mw.CreatePart(ra.mimeHeader(mimeType, totalSize))
+ if e != nil {
+ pw.CloseWithError(e)
+ return
+ }
+ if _, e = rs.Seek(ra.start, 0); e != nil {
+ pw.CloseWithError(e)
+ return
+ }
+ if _, e = io.CopyN(part, rs, ra.length); e != nil {
+ pw.CloseWithError(e)
+ return
+ }
+ }
+ mw.Close()
+ pw.Close()
+ }()
+ if ctx.Response.Header.Peek("Content-Encoding") == nil {
+ ctx.Response.Header.Set("Content-Length", strconv.FormatInt(sendSize, 10))
+ }
+ ctx.Response.Header.SetStatusCode(http.StatusPartialContent)
+ _, e = io.CopyN(ctx.Response.BodyWriter(), sendContent, sendSize)
+ return e
+}
